    Using Personal Rapid Transit as an Effective Transport Solution in Historical Downtown Areas: a Case From Historic Kemeraltı, İzmir
    (TMMOB Şehir Plancıları Odası, 2023) Duvarcı, Yavuz; Akpınar, Figen; Akpınar, Figen; Duvarcı, Yavuz; 02.03. Department of City and Regional Planning; 02. Faculty of Architecture; 01. Izmir Institute of Technology
    Many issues related to the conservation of urban heritage are closely related to the transit system and the use of private trans-portation. Regeneration, revitalization, and/or heritage conser-vation are not properly managed due to problems arising directly from inconvenient transport solutions that cannot provide or resolve the accessibility and mobility needs of vulnerable groups together with inappropriate space management while indirectly causing economic shrinkage and loss of vitality. Furthermore, even if modern modes of transportation are used, they will cause significant environmental and societal difficulties, making them unsuitable for such sensitive places. This article, using a micro -simulation approach, investigates whether a Personal Rapid Tran-sit system is physically applicable, and whether it can meet exist-ing travel requirements to prove that it is sufficient for the needs of local level mobility, and finally whether other environmental/ social impacts such that land use, air pollution, safety, sustainabil-ity are positive or negative. As a method, these outputs of the system application are presented as validations of the usefulness of the PRT. Finally, it was found that there is a gain in productiv-ity in terms of mobility as well as other socio-economic benefits besides the physical applicability of the method. The study's goal is to get the information out about how PRT technology may help produce more ecologically friendly and sustainable solutions while also conserving historical assets.

    Do Spatial Development Plans Provide Spatial Equity in Access To Public Parks: a Case With a Residential Area in Karabağlar and Buca (i̇zmir)
    (TMMOB Şehir Plancıları Odası, 2022) Öztürk, Sevim Pelin; Şenol, Fatma; Şenol, Fatma; 02.03. Department of City and Regional Planning; 02. Faculty of Architecture; 01. Izmir Institute of Technology
    Public parks' location is one of the major factors shaping their accessibility. Many natural and physical features (e.g., topography, stream ways, street network, traffic density, road junctions, and land uses) affect walking distances from dwellings to these loca- tions. Also, the cost of access (measured in time and meter) to these locations vary among age groups with different walk- ing capacities. Spatial plans in Turkey are the documents for de- termining and implementing the allocation of parks. However, plan-making practices have limitations in considering the park accessibility by walking among different groups of dwellers. This study considers the accessibility of public parks as an issue of spatial equity. It evaluates the park accessibility at a recent spatial plan about a residential area in Karabağlar and Buca Districts of İzmir. It aims to assess the allocations of planned parks and propose potential locations for new park areas. With a point- based approach to park accessibility, the study analysis performs the Location-Allocation (LA) Analysis with multiple criteria at Geographic Information Systems. The results show that at the plan, the specified residential area has spatial inequities with park accessibility. Among the other planned public service areas, some locations can be re-planned as new park areas, which partially im- proves spatial inequities at the plan. Also, the study is an example of how to prepare and run the data for the spatial analysis of allocations of public service areas with the help of GIS in Turkey

    Bicycle Route Infrastructure Planning Using Gis in an Urban Area: the Case of Izmir
    (TMMOB Şehir Plancıları Odası, 2020) Özkan, Sevim Pelin; Şenol, Fatma; Şenol, Fatma; Özçam, Zeynep; 02.03. Department of City and Regional Planning; 02. Faculty of Architecture; 01. Izmir Institute of Technology
    As a case study about İzmir (the third biggest metropolitan city in Turkey), this paper focuses on how to determine bicycle routes in already developed built environments of densely populated cities. To do so, it identifies how to deploy certain geographic information system (GIS) tools for analyzing multilayered spatial data not only at the city but also at the neighborhood level. When interrelating multiple characteristics of majorly topography, land use and population with each other, the study deploys mainly the overlay analysis and also network analysis as complementary to each other respectively at the city level and the neighborhood level. The results confirms that the use of these GIS tools for analyzing socio-spatial data especially at multiple spatial scales can support policy-makers’ decision-makings about route choices in the immediate future of their city even in a “data-poor” context,” such as Turkey.
